Mobile Infrastructure Corp focuses on acquiring, owning, and leasing parking facilities and related infrastructure, including parking lots, parking garages and other parking structures throughout the United States. It operates in a single reportable segment: parking. The parking segment derives revenue from managed property revenue and rental income at parking facilities. The company provide access to property and space for the parker's vehicle and charges fees that vary based on the level of usage. The company derives all of its revenue domestically.
Gauzy Ltd is a fully integrated light and vision control company. Its products include suspended particle device and liquid crystal materials for smart glass applications and AI-powered driver assistance systems, or ADAS, solutions including camera monitoring systems. The company's operating segments are Architecture, Automotive, Safety tech, and Aeronautics. Maximum revenue is generated from its Safety tech segment, which focuses on sales of driver assistance systems for buses, coaches, recreational vehicles, and specific vehicles, such as camera and motion sensor systems, smart mirrors, and safety doors. Geographically, it derives maximum revenue from other European countries (excluding France), followed by the United States, France, Asia, Israel, and other regions.
